+ ## When to Use
+ - **Turbopack (default dev)**: Use for day-to-day development. Faster cold start and HMR, especially in large apps.
+ - **Webpack (legacy dev)**: Use only if you hit a Turbopack bug or rely on a webpack-only plugin in dev. Disable with `--webpack` (or `--no-turbopack` depending on your Next.js version; check the docs for your release).
+ - **Production**: Production build behavior (`next build`) may use Turbopack or webpack depending on Next.js version; check the official Next.js docs for your version.
+
+ Use when: developing or debugging Next.js 16+ apps, diagnosing slow dev startup or HMR, or optimizing production bundles.

- ## File-System Caching
-
- Turbopack caches work on disk so that:
-
- - Restarts reuse previous work; second run is much faster.
- - Large projects see 5โ14x faster compile times on restart in practice.
- - Cache is typically under `.next` or a similar project-local directory; no extra config needed for basic use.
-
- ## Bundle Analyzer (Next.js 16.1+)
-
- Next.js 16.1 introduced an experimental Bundle Analyzer to inspect output and find heavy dependencies:
